Police are asking witnesses of a fatal collision last Saturday to come forward and provide a statement.

The collision occurred at roughly 8:20 p.m. Feb. 23 at the intersection of St. Albert Trail and Hebert Road. St. Albert RCMP report that a northbound car collided with an SUV making a left turn onto Hebert Road. The impact forced the car to wrap around a lamppost, killing the male passenger.

RCMP did not release the name of the victim, but a handwritten note on a roadside memorial as well as a public Facebook group identified him as 20-year-old Mike Mclean.

The 26-year-old driver of the car was taken to hospital with non life threatening injuries. No injuries were reported by occupants in the SUV.

RCMP continue to investigate the collision and have not ruled out speed or alcohol as factors.

Anyone who witnessed the collision is being asked to contact St. Albert RCMP at 780-458-7700.
